Condemnation of private property (third class cities).

88.497. Private property may be taken by the cities of thethird class for public use for the purpose of establishing,opening, widening, extending or altering any street, avenue,alley, wharf, creek, river, watercourse, market place, publicpark or public square, and for establishing market houses, andfor any other necessary public purposes.

(RSMo 1939 § 6998)

Prior revisions: 1929 § 6852; 1919 § 8334; 1909 § 9261
